Analysis of the relationship between defenseless spaces and environmental variables using the GIS. Case study: Region 3 of Ardabil.
Unprotected urban spaces are a threat to the security of citizens. Therefore, their organization is essential for the promotion of social security. The purpose of the present study is to explore and analyze the relationship between urban defensible spaces and environmental variables.
The research area is Ardebil Municipality District 3. Urban independent spaces include 172 independent variable locations of this study identified through field surveys. Exploratory variables included population and building density, income groups, passage network quality, physical texture of urban textures, social cohesion of neighborhoods, land and building prices, and land use. GIS techniques such as mean center method, standard deviation ellipse, spatial autocorrelation for spatial analysis and geographic regression method were used to explain the correlation between variables.
Crime spaces occur in less extensive areas and tend to focus within certain areas of Region 3. The number of these spaces decreases to the north and south. Also, these defenseless spaces have spatial self-correlation and are distributed as clusters and imbalances at the regional level. As a result, certain ranges are the focus of the defenseless spaces studied and follow the centralized pattern. Also, there is a significant relationship between 8 environmental variables studied in the study of defenseless urban spaces in the 3rd district of Ardabil city.
Research findings show that there is a significant relationship between defensible spaces and environmental variables. The result is that environmental variables have a direct impact on the formation and growth or destruction and elimination of defenseless spaces.
